Profiling diverse sequence tandem repeats in colorectal cancer reveals co-occurrence of microsatellite and chromosomal instability involving Chromosome 8
2020-12-24
Abstract excerpt
<h4>ABSTRACT</h4> Colorectal carcinomas (CRCs) which have lost DNA mismatch repair display hypermutability evident in a molecular phenotype called microsatellite instability (MSI) . These mismatch repair deficient tumors are thought to lack widespread genomic instability features, such as copy number changes and rearrangements.
